    Optimization of the Extracting Process of Total Organic Acid from Cassia Twig by Orthogonal Experiment with Ethanol Reflux

    • OBJECTIVE To study the optimum extraction technology of total organic acids in Cassia Twig. METHODS Using total organic acid extraction rate as index to investigate the effection of the extraction results by ethanol concentration, dosage of ethanol, extraction times with orthogonal design test. RESULTS Optimum extraction process were as follows: ethanol concentration of 90%, 8 times solvent dosage, extraction for 3 times. CONCLUSION The process proceeds higher extraction yield, stability, repeatability is good, suitable for the extraction of total organic acids.
